York Electric Cooperative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 90,308,767 | 90,308,767 | 0 | 7.5 | 1% |
| 2012 | 91,640,382 | 91,640,382 | 0 | 7.5 | 1% |
| 2013 | 95,199,138 | 95,199,138 | 0 | 7.9 | 1% |
| 2014 | 103,940,539 | 103,940,539 | 0 | 7.6 | 0% |
| 2015 | 110,087,761 | 109,994,307 | 93,454 | 7.2 | 0% |
| 2016 | 116,111,302 | 115,975,024 | 136,278 | 7.2 | 0% |
| 2017 | 117,166,625 | 117,166,625 | 0 | 7.4 | 0% |
| 2018 | 127,940,953 | 127,940,953 | 0 | 7.1 | 1% |
| 2019 | 130,737,382 | 130,737,382 | 0 | 8.2 | 0% |
| 2020 | 128,825,195 | 128,825,195 | 0 | 8.6 | 0% |
| 2021 | 132,392,701 | 132,392,701 | 0 | 9.5 | 0% |
| 2022 | 136,652,507 | 136,652,507 | 0 | 9.7 | 0% |
| 2023 | 141,230,800 | 141,230,800 | 0 | 9.9 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$0 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 9.9 months of spending, up from 7.5 in 2011.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
